B
The British are famous as animal lovers, and in a nation of about 60 million people, there are about 27 million pets! The most popular pets are dogs and cats.
Many British people say that the main reason they have a pet is to keep them company (陪伴他们). According to a recent report, 60% of people who live on their own have a pet as company. A lot of pet owners treat their pet just like one of the family. Many cat owners make holes in their doors so their cats can come and go as they please. Dog owners spend a lot of time walking their dogs.
Another reason to own a pet is for protection, especially dogs. Most thieves would think twice about breaking into (闯入) a house if they could hear a large dog barking inside. Some people choose their pets because of their beauty. The most beautiful animals can win prizes at pet shows!
In the UK, some pet owners think that nothing is too good for their animal! Some people take their pet to the animal doctor more often than they visit their own doctor. They might even take a day off work to care for a pet when it is sick. Many people talk to their pets, and some talk to them over the telephone. And of course, they mustn’t forget to celebrate the animal’s birthday!
19. According to the passage, the number of the pets in the UK is ________ million.
A. more than16 B. about 27 C. more than 36 D. about 60
20. The main reason the British have a pet is to ________.
A. win prizes at pet shows B. protect the houses
C. keep them company D. go for a walk with them
21. The underlined expression “think twice” in the passage probably means “________” in Chinese.
A. 竭尽全力 B. 想方设法 C. 念念不忘 D. 三思而行
22. From the last paragraph we know that some pet owners in the UK think their pets are ________.
A. important B. dangerous C. successful D. beautiful
【答案】19. B 20. C 21. D 22. A
【解析】
【导语】本文介绍了英国人爱养宠物及养宠的相关原因与表现。
【19题详解】
文章第一段第二句“...in a nation of about 60 million people, there are about 27 million pets!”给出了英国的宠物数量大约是2700万。
【20题详解】
第二段第一句指出原因:“Many British people say that the main reason they have a pet is to keep them company.”,英国人养宠物的主要原因是为了陪伴。
【21题详解】
根据第三段“Most thieves would think twice about breaking into a house if they could hear a large dog barking inside.”可知,如果小偷听到屋里有大狗叫声,他们会在闯入房子前认真考虑,因为可能会有危险。由此可推测,think twice意为“三思而行”。
【22题详解】
根据最后一段“some pet owners think that nothing is too good for their animal!”以及“take their pet to the animal doctor more often than they visit their own doctor”和“celebrate the animal’s birthday”可知,一些英国宠物主人认为宠物非常重要,愿意花费很多时间和精力照顾它们。

四、语篇填空(共两节,20分)
第一节(共10小题;每小题1分,共10分)
阅读短文内容,在空白处填入一个适当的单词或括号内单词的正确形式。
You have been working hard to learn English. Many people find it hard ____31____ (learn) the language. Well, how about Chinese? Do you know more and more ____32____ (foreign) are trying to learn Chinese? According to a survey, one in four American young men would like to learn it. There had been over 30 million people learning Chinese around the world ____33____ the end of 2024. “Because of China’s fast ____34____ (develop), Chinese has become more useful in ____35____ (communicate) between people. More and more people begin to learn it,” said Scott McGinnis, ____36____ Washington language expert.
____37____ Chinese is becoming more and more popular, it is one of the most difficult ____38____ (language) to learn. Usually, it will take an English ____39____ (speak) about 1,320 hours to become good at Chinese. It takes only 480 hours for ____40____ (France), Spanish or Italian.
【答案】31. to learn
32. foreigners
33. by 34. development
35. communication
36. a 37. Although##Though
38. languages
39. speaker
40. French
【解析】
【导语】本文讲述越来越多外国人学习中文,受中国快速发展的影响中文实用性提升;同时指出中文虽越来越流行,但学习难度很大,对比不同语言需要的学习时长。
【31题详解】
句意:很多人发现学习这门语言很难。find it+adj.+to do sth,it作形式宾语,不定式to do作真正宾语,learn的不定式为to learn。
【32题详解】
句意:你知道越来越多的外国人正在努力学习中文吗?more and more后接名词复数,foreign的名词形式为foreigner,其复数形式为foreigners。
【33题详解】
句意:到2024年底,全世界已有超过3000万人学习中文。by the end of+时间“到……末”,此处需用介词by。
【34题详解】
句意:由于中国的快速发展,中文在人与人之间的交流中变得更加有用。名词所有格China’s后面接名词,develop对应的名词形式为development。
【35题详解】
句意:由于中国的快速发展,中文在人与人之间的交流中变得更加有用。介词in后面接名词,communicate对应的名词形式为communication。
【36题详解】
句意:一位华盛顿的语言专家Scott McGinnis说道。expert是可数名词单数,Washington为辅音音素开头,用不定冠词a,表示“一位专家”。
【37题详解】
句意:虽然中文正变得越来越受欢迎,但它是最难学的语言之一。前后句为让步关系,Although/Though“虽然”,引导让步状语从句。
【38题详解】
句意:虽然中文正变得越来越受欢迎,但它是最难学的语言之一。one of +the+形容词最高级+名词复数,表示“最……之一”,language变复数languages。
【39题详解】
句意:一名讲英语的人要花费大约1320小时才能学好中文。English speaker“讲英语的人”,此处需用speak的名词speaker。
【40题详解】
句意:学习法语、西班牙语或者意大利语只需要480小时。此处需和后面Spanish、Italian并列,指语言,France对应的语言名词为French。
第二节(共5小题,每小题2分,共10分)
阅读短文,从方框中选择适当的词或词组并用正确形式填空,使短文通顺意思完整。(每词或词组限用一次)
something late shop popular describe
Why is “buy things” in Chinese spoken as maidongxi (buy east and west), but not mainanbei (buy south and north)?
One explanation is that in the Tang Dynasty, there were two ____41____ markets in Chang’an, the Capital of China at the time. One was called the East Market, and the other was called the West Market. When ____42____, people usually went to the East Market first, and then went to the West Market. As time went by, people started to ____43____ shopping as “buy east and west”.
Also, it may have ____44____ to do with China’s trading history. Around the 15th century, China began trading with the world, and most of its imported (进口的) goods came from the east (Japan) and west (Arabia,阿拉伯半岛). Markets sold “things from the east and west”, and ____45____ it was simplified (简化) to “east and west”.
【答案】41.
popular 42.
shopping 43.
describe 44.
something 45.
later
【解析】
【导语】本文是一篇说明文,主要介绍了为什么“buy things”中文叫“买东西”而不是“买南北”。文中列举了一些有关的解释,说明“买东西”的来由。
【41题详解】
句意:一种解释是,在唐朝时期,中国的首都长安有两个受欢迎的市场。此处缺少形容词修饰名词markets,结合句意可知是指唐代长安有两个“受欢迎的”市场,popular“受欢迎的”符合。
【42题详解】
句意:购物时,人们通常先去东市,然后再去西市。When引导时间状语从句,此处表达购物时,shop“购物”符合,当从句主语与主句一致时可省略主语和be动词,此处shop变为现在分词shopping。
【43题详解】
句意:随着时间的推移,人们开始将购物描述为 “买东西”。start to do sth. 意为“开始做某事”,后接动词原形;固定搭配describe...as... 意为“把……描述为……”,符合句意。
【44题详解】
句意:此外,这可能与中国的贸易历史有关。固定短语have something to do with意为“与……有关系”,符合语境。
【45题详解】
句意:市场出售 “东西方的东西”,后来简化为 “东西”。此处作状语表示时间上的推移,late需变为副词later,意为“后来”。
